Butler Battles UW-Milwaukee To A 2-2 Tie
Oct. 9, 2006
Senior John DeVae scored a pair of unassisted goals to help Butler to a 2-2 tie in overtime at UW-Milwaukee in a Horizon League men's soccer match on Sunday, Oct. 8. The match, Butler's third overtime contest of the week, left the Bulldogs with a 4-7-2 overall record and a 1-3-1 mark in league play. DeVae gave the Bulldogs a 1-0 lead just over ten minutes into the match when he beat UW-Milwaukee's defense and nailed a shot from 12 yards out. He then tied the match in the 65th minute with his fourth goal of the season. The Butler forward picked up a loose ball and fired a shot past Panters' goalkeeper Grant Fernstrum from eight yards out. UW-Milwaukee (4-8-2, 1-2-1 Horizon League) initially tied the match at 37:20 on a header by Chris Lins. The Panthers then took the lead at 52:50 on a tap-in by Colin Baker after a shot by Troy Spielmann was blocked. Both teams battled through two scoreless overtime periods. Butler had two shots in the final overtime period, but both were wide. The Panthers had one shot on goal in the second overtime period, but goalkeeper Frank Peabody came up with the stop. Peabody finished with six saves, including five in the second half and two overtime periods.
